- Rich literary tradition: Kerala has a rich literary tradition, with a strong influence of Sanskrit, Malayalam, and other languages.
- Ayurveda and wellness: Kerala is famous for its Ayurvedic traditions, with many centers and practitioners offering holistic wellness treatments.
- Cuisine: Kerala cuisine is known for its use of coconut, spices, and fish, with popular dishes like sadya, thoran, and karimeen.
- Festivals and traditions: Kerala celebrates many festivals, including Onam, Vishu, and Thrissur Pooram, which showcase its rich cultural heritage.
